Orange Scented Hot Chocolate recipe

Ingredients

2 cups milk
4 oz chocolate
3 2-inch strips oranges peel
1/2 tsp espresso
1/8 tsp ground nutmeg


1. Combine milk, chocolate (chopped bittersweet or semi-sweet ); orange peel, espresso (instant coffee); and nutmeg in a heavy medium saucepan. Stir over low heat until chocolate melts, increase heat and bring just to a boil, stirring often. Remove from heat and whisk until frothy.

2. Return to heat and bring to boil again. Remove from heat, whisk until frothy. Repeat heating and whisking once again.

3. Discard orange peel. (Can be prepared 2 hours ahead. Let stand at room temperature. Before serving, bring just to boil, remove from heat and whisk until frothy.) Pour hot chocolate into coffee mugs. Makes 2 servings.

Dutch Coffee recipe

Ingredients

1 oz oude genever gin
5 oz hot black coffee
1 1/2 oz whipped cream
1 tsp sugar


Pour coffee and liquor into an irish coffee cup and sweeten to taste. Gently float the cream on top, and sprinkle with nutmeg.
